Dr. Joseph Yeager, Ph.D.
Dr. Yeager consults to domestic and international companies on competitive positioning strategy and senior executive coaching using technology he developed which is in worldwide use among Fortune 500 clientele. His work has surpassed the classic quantitative and qualitative measurement technologies by developing a third field of psychometric measurement featuring psycholinguistic-systems analysis for motivational profiling. With this behavioral engineering technology, psycholinguistic mechanisms driving behavior change have been developed and used for the prediction and modification of human behavior ranging from individuals to organizations to populations. Interventions in corporations, team-work, marketing and advertising that precisely change behavior have advanced the behavioral field by a generation. Dr. Yeager continues to advance the envelope of motivation, persuasion, influence and decision-making technologies. Dr. Yeager behavioral engineering technology amplifies executive and corporate business results. He publishes in major management and psychology journals where he also edits for refereed journals. He has written numerous books on human behavior and business performance. Before starting his own firm in 1975, he was a senior executive in the airline, pharmaceutical and psychological testing industries.


Linda Sommer, Ph.D.
As a principle and Chairman of Sommer Consulting, Inc. Dr. Sommer has expanded the role of the company into a highly visible force within the international business community, garnering a strong following in numerous industries. SCI provides state of the art market research providing solutions and answers unobtainable by conventional means. In addition to corporate strategy work, Dr. Sommer has coached executives and officers in the Fortune 500 companies for over twenty years and has been much sought after as a key-note motivational speaker on several continents. One of her specialties is quickly developing executives into powerful communicators and leaders in the context of escalating demands on corporate performance. She has been a major player in IPO's, corporate reorganizations and corporate turnarounds. She has developed many entrepreneurial business situations as a venture capitalist. A great deal of her work is embedded within many of the advertising campaigns seen in today's media and she is a published author in the business press and in professional journals.
